Blige dismisses 'Idol' rumours


Mary J. Blige has denied reports she's set to replace Paula Abdul as a permanent judge on reality TV competition American Idol.

The No More Drama hitmaker was booked as a guest panellist on the singing competition after Abdul's departure in August.

Idol producers have also roped in Victoria Beckham, Katy Perry, Shania Twain and Neil Patrick Harris to critique contestants alongside original judges Simon Cowell, Randy Jackson and Kara DioGuardi on the upcoming season.

However, Blige insists she's not considering taking a permanent seat on the show.

She tells the New York Daily News, "I'm not gonna be the next Paula Abdul. There was, maybe, three women that were incredible and three guys. The rest of it? A lot of it was like, "You can't be serious!"
